45游戏网-游戏爱好者乐园

45游戏网-游戏爱好者乐园

如何用做游戏

59

制作游戏是一个涉及多个步骤的复杂过程,以下是一些基本指南:

确定游戏类型和核心机制

在开始之前,确定你想要制作的游戏类型(如动作冒险、角色扮演、益智游戏等)。

设计游戏的基本规则和机制,包括游戏目标、玩家互动和胜利条件。

学习游戏开发工具和编程语言

选择一个适合你需求的游戏开发工具,如Unity、Unreal Engine、Godot、Construct、Stencyl等。

学习基础的编程概念,常用的编程语言包括C、JavaScript、Python等。

游戏设计和开发

编写游戏剧情和脚本,设计游戏角色和场景。

使用图形和建模软件创建游戏所需的图像和3D模型。

添加背景音乐和音效,提升游戏的沉浸感。

使用游戏开发软件进行代码编写,实现游戏逻辑和功能。

测试和调试

对游戏进行全流程测试,找出并修复错误和不足。

进行性能优化,确保游戏运行流畅。

发布和分享

将游戏发布到各大应用商店或游戏平台,如App Store、Google Play、Steam等。

分享你的游戏给朋友和玩家,收集反馈并持续改进。

UnityUnreal Engine:适合制作3D游戏,提供强大的图形和编程支持。

Godot:一个轻量级的2D游戏开发引擎,易于上手。

ConstructStencyl:适合初学者,提供可视化的游戏开发环境。

Pygame:一个用于开发2D游戏的Python库,适合初学者快速入门。

Cocos2d:一个用于开发2D游戏的Python框架,支持多种平台。

通过以上步骤和工具,你可以开始你的游戏开发之旅。记得在开发过程中不断学习和尝试,享受创作的过程。